Ever since acai was touted on the Oprah Winfrey Show as one of the “Top Ten Superfoods“, we have been hearing more about the benefits of this berry. Acai is a Brazilian berry oftentimes considered one of nature’s most complete and healthy foods.

The acai berry is loaded with anthocyanins (20 times that in red wine), antioxidants, amino acids, essential omegas, fibers and protein.

PURPLEThe Purple Beverage Company has created a new beverage – PURPLE. This all natural, sugar-free drink combines the acai berry with six otheraantioxidant rich juices – black currant, black cherry, pomegranate, purple plum, cranberry and blueberry.

Researchers, including those from Tuft’s University and the Scottish Crop Research Institute, say that the antioxidants found in black currants can aid in warding off all sorts of ailments, including heart disease, cancer, Alzheimer’s disease, diabetes and high blood pressure.
